This Bank Holiday weekend will bring warm weather with a mix of sunshine and rain, Met Éireann has said.

Today will be mostly dry with cloudy skies over Ulster and Connacht. Meanwhile, it will be sunnier elsewhere with some patches of mist and fog.

Cloud will spread to the south to cover most of the country this morning and afternoon. A few places in the north and west might see light rain and drizzle. It will be a warm day with temperatures ranging between 16 to 21 degrees.

It will be the warmest in the south of the country, which will enjoy the best of the sunshine, and slightly cooler in the northwest.

Tonight will continue to be mostly cloudy. There will be some patches of light rain, drizzle and mist, which are most likely in Ulster and Connacht. Temperatures will drop to 9 to 13 degrees.

Tomorrow will remain cloudy with some rain or drizzle in places, which will become patchier throughout the day. There might be some bright or sunny intervals developing.

Temperatures will be from 14 to 18 degrees, while they could reach up to 19 and 20 degrees in the south and southeast which will enjoy the best of sunny spells.

A cloudy Monday night will bring patchy light rain coming from the west, turning more persistent for Atlantic coastal counties towards dawn. Temperatures might drop to 10 and 13 degrees.

Tuesday will be largely cloudy and damp in the morning with outbreaks of light rain or drizzle. Northwest will see sunny spells in the morning, extending across the country by the early afternoon.

It will be followed by some showers, which will be most frequent and might turn heavy in the north. Temperatures will range between 13 and 18 degrees, while it will be the coolest in the north and west.

Tuesday night is expected to be dry and clear for most of the country. It will turn cloudier in the north and west with some scattered showers. Temperatures will drop to 5 and 9 degrees.

This week will be mixed and cooler due to rain and showers at times, however it will also bring some sunny spells, Met Éireann has said.
